Output 3a59a7f1bdff76f2b7861f85fae0a9a430af248de3c286be23ebebad82e0ad60:12

value
1541203
script pubkey
OP_0 OP_PUSHBYTES_20 ca6bc20ef3ee3a28f6157995e36176dbdfa5773b
address
bc1qef4uyrhnacaz3as40x27xctkm0062aemgh9f9r
transaction
3a59a7f1bdff76f2b7861f85fae0a9a430af248de3c286be23ebebad82e0ad60
spent
false